MCGS组态软件在恒压供水控制系统中的应用

更新时间:2023-09-02 07:03:02 阅读量: 教育文库 文档下载

说明:文章内容仅供预览,部分内容可能不全。下载后的文档,内容与下面显示的完全一致。下载之前请确认下面内容是否您想要的,是否完整无缺。

科技信息○机械与电子○SCIENCE&TECHNOLOGYINFORMATION2009年第15期

MCGS组态软件在恒压供水控制系统中的应用

赵晓莹

(安徽机电职业技术学院安徽

芜湖

241000)

【摘要】基于MCGS(MonitorandControlGenerateSystem)组态软件的恒压供水系统采用主从式结构,上位机采用MCGS组态软件为监控软件,对液位信息进行实时监控;下位机以PLC为核心,进行液位信息的采集和转换,并与上位机进行信息交互,实现恒压供水的目的。

【关键词】恒压供水;MCGS组态软件;

PLC

0.引言

目前许多领域都要对液位进行监控,如水位的检测、油罐液位的检测、锅炉液位检测等等,有很多领域人可能无法靠近或现场无需人力来监控。我们就可以通过远程监控,坐在办公室里对现场进行监控,又方便又节省人力。本文介绍了一种恒压供水控制系统,该系统采用S7-200CPU224型PLC作为控制核心,上位机采用MCGS编写的监控软件,整个监控系统可以完成液位信号的采集与转换、数据传送和显示、控制等功能。

连接窗口中,将A/D、D/A通道和实时数据库中的数据对象对应连接起来。

2.2.5运行策略组态:完成工程运行流程的控制。该系统采用PID控制算法,根据系统的控制算法及要完成的特定流程和操作处理,在MCGS的“运行策略”窗口中,对系统的“启动策略”、“循环策略”、“存盘策略”等分别进行组态和设置。完成组态后的液位控制系统的运行主控窗口如图2所示。

1.MCGS组态软件

MCGS(MonitorandControlGeneratedSystem,通用监控系统)组态软件是北京昆仑通态自动化软件科技有限公司开发的,用于快速构造和生成计算机监控系统,它能够在基于Microsoft的各种32Windows平台上运行,通过对现场数据采集处理,以动画显示、报警处理、流程控制和报表输出等各种方式向用户提供解决实际工程问题的方案,在自动化领域有着广泛的使用。

MCGS系统包括组态环境和运行环境两个部分,具体的组态过程包括系统菜单和系统参数组态、设备构件组态、用户界面组态、实时数据对象组态和运行策略组态。

2.基于组态软件的液位控制系统实现

2.1恒压供水控制系统硬件结构

系统采用S7-200CPU224型PLC、EM235模拟量扩展模块、电磁调节阀、压力式液位传感器、AI-808变送器及其他控制设备组成。系统结构图如图1所示。

图2

计算机控制界面组态结构图

3.实验测试

根据系统原理图完成硬件电路接线工作,完成MCGS软件的调试运行工作。三相380V/10A交流电源向三相磁力泵供电,单相220/5A交流电源向电动调节阀供电。压力变送器输出的4~20mA标准电流信号(水箱液位检测信号)串联250Ω电阻,转变为1~5V的标准电压信号,送入智能采集模块ICP-7017输入通道,再经A/D转化将液位信号送到计算机。智能采集模块ICP-7024接收计算机离散控制信号,经D/A转换为模拟信号,其输出通道与24V开关电源以及电动调节阀信号输入端口相串联,从而输出的4~20mA标准电流信号(水箱液位控制信号)送给电磁调节阀,控制其开度。

经调试,参数整定结果如下:比例系数P=20,积分时间I=80,微分时间D=10。此时该液位控制系统具有良好的稳态性能和动态性能。

图1恒压供水控制系统结构图

被控对象为水箱水位,压力式液位传感器检测水箱水位信号,转换成4~20mA电信号,经AI-808变送器将电流信号转换成1~5V的电压信号送入PLC模块。PLC把这个测量信号与设定值比较得到偏差,经PID运算后,发出控制信号,控制电磁调节阀。利用电磁调节阀的开度来调节入水量的大小,上位机通过RS485总线与PLC进行数据交换,系统的给定信号由MCGS在上位机上给定,在MCGS监控画面上可以显示测量值,从而达到恒压供水的目的。

2.2组态软件设计

在完成系统的硬件结构设计后,就可以用MCGS组态软件对该系统进行组态,具体组态过程如下:

2.2.1用户窗口组态:主要用于设置工程中的人机交互界面,如系统的主控界面、曲线图、动画等。

2.2.2主控窗口组态:是工程的主窗口或主框架。“用户窗口”组态完成之后,在“主控窗口”中,通过对系统菜单和参数的定义与设置来调度、管理这些用户窗口的打开或关闭。

2.2.3实时数据库组态:是工程各个部分数据交换与处理中心,它将MCGS工程的各个部分连成有机的整体。按照系统设计的实际需要,在MCGS的“实时数据库窗口”中对系统所创建的数据对象的基本属性、存盘属性、报警属性进行定义和设置。

2.2.4设备构件组态:是连接和驱动外部设备的工作环境。在通道

4.结束语

本文以恒压供水控制系统为例,介绍了MCGS组态软件开发上位机系统的过程。该上位机系统采用MCGS编写的监控软件,整个监控系统可以完成液位信号的采集与转换、数据传送和显示、控制等功能。为工业现场中的液位控制提供了理论依据和实用的控制方法。科

【参考文献】

[1]北京昆仑通态自动化有限公司.MCGS高级教程[M].2006.

[2]吴文进,张杰.基于MCGS组态软件的PID液位控制[J].安庆师范学院学报

(自然科学版),2008,8(14):50-53.

[3]金以慧.过程控制(第一版)[M].北京:清华大学出版社,1993:108-117.[4]田淑珍.可编程控制器原理及应用.北京:机械工业出版社,2008.

[5]刘金琨.先进PID控制及MALAB仿真(第二版)[M].北京:电子工业出版社,2004(9):2-7.

作者简介:赵晓莹,女,安徽芜湖人,安徽机电职业技术学院助教。

[责任编辑:韩铭]

469

本文来源:https://www.bwwdw.com/article/vkai.html

Top